Materials and Food-Safe Construction
Ice cream cups face unique challenges: they must withstand freezing temperatures, resist moisture from melting products, maintain structural integrity when held, and comply with food safety regulations. Our wholesale recyclable ice cream cups utilize advanced paper engineering to address these demands through sustainable materials.
Premium paperboard from 250 gsm to 350 gsm creates rigid cup walls that maintain shape throughout the serving experience. The substantial thickness prevents cups from collapsing when gripped or becoming soggy as ice cream melts. Heavier weights suit premium portions or dense frozen products like gelato, while moderate weights work for standard servings and lighter frozen yogurt applications. The paperboard accepts printing beautifully while providing natural insulation that keeps frozen treats cold longer than thin plastic alternatives.
Aqueous coating provides moisture barrier properties using water-based formulations that maintain compostability. This coating prevents liquid penetration as ice cream melts while allowing cups to break down naturally in commercial composting facilities. The treatment creates smooth interior surfaces that release frozen products cleanly without sticking, enhancing customer experience. Unlike plastic-lined cups that compromise recyclability, aqueous coatings maintain the paper cup's environmental profile throughout its lifecycle.
Double-wall construction available for premium specifications creates insulating air gaps that protect hands from freezing temperatures while keeping products colder longer. The construction uses two paper layers with minimal spacing, providing thermal barriers without requiring foam sleeves or separate insulators. This integrated approach maintains recyclability while delivering comfort and performance customers appreciate during extended enjoyment periods.
Reinforced rolled rims create smooth lip edges comfortable for eating while adding structural support preventing crush damage when cups stack. The reinforcement distributes stress from stacking across the rim circumference, allowing efficient storage and display without cups nesting so tightly they become difficult to separate. Smooth rims also enhance the eating experience, as rough edges would detract from product enjoyment.
Food-grade compliance ensures all materials and coatings meet FDA requirements for direct food contact with no harmful chemical migration into frozen products. The natural paperboard composition means no concerning compounds leach into ice cream, even with extended contact time. This safety profile proves especially important for businesses serving children or customers with chemical sensitivities who scrutinize food contact materials carefully.
All specifications maintain full recyclability through standard paper recycling streams and compostability in commercial facilities, creating multiple responsible end-of-life pathways. Many municipalities accept these cups in paper recycling even with minor food residue, as processing facilities handle contamination from frozen desserts readily. Some areas with commercial composting accept cups directly in organics collection, where they break down completely alongside food waste.

Size Range for Different Serving Formats
Proper cup sizing ensures appropriate portion control, minimizes material waste, and meets customer expectations for value. Our wholesale recyclable ice cream cups come in standard dessert industry sizes plus custom options for signature servings.
Sample size (3 oz) cups suit tasting portions, kids servings, or sam For related packaging needs, explore our subscription packaging.pling programs. The petite capacity encourages customers to try multiple flavors while controlling costs for promotional tastings. Despite small size, these cups accept full-color branding comparable to larger formats, ensuring brand consistency across your serving size range. The efficient material usage keeps per-unit costs low, making elaborate printing economically viable even for complimentary samples.
Small size (5-6 oz) represents kids portions or light servings for calorie-conscious customers. This size balances satisfying treat experience with portion control, appealing to parents and customers managing intake. The moderate dimensions work well for premium gelato where rich flavors satisfy in smaller quantities. Many dessert shops use this size for base menu pricing, with larger sizes available as upsells.
Medium size (8-10 oz) functions as the standard single serving for most ice cream shops. This size accommodates two to three scoops comfortably with room for toppings without overflowing. The capacity matches customer expectations for regular portions while providing adequate exterior surface for meaningful branding. This size typically represents the highest volume usage, making it the primary focus for custom printing investment.
Large size (12-16 oz) serves generous portions, sundaes, or multiple-scoop orders with elaborate toppings. The increased depth prevents overflow when layering ice cream with sauces, fruits, nuts, and whipped cream. Customers perceive these sizes as premium offerings justifying higher pricing, with the substantial cups reinforcing value perception. The expanded exterior surface provides ample canvas for elaborate branding or promotional messaging.
Extra-large size (20-24 oz) handles specialty applications like banana splits, family portions, or signature oversized servings. While less common for everyday service, access to this size supports menu variety and special occasion offerings. The dramatic size commands attention and creates social media moments as customers photograph impressive portions. Some shops use oversized cups strategically for challenges or shareable desserts that generate buzz and foot traffic.
Custom sizes ensure perfect fit for signature servings or unique frozen dessert formats. Our team calculates optimal cup dimensions based on your typical portions and topping practices, ensuring cups accommodate menu items without excess capacity inflating costs. This service proves valuable for shops with distinctive serving styles or frozen products that don't conform to standard ice cream portions, like affogato servings or specialty frozen drinks.
Environmental Impact and Sustainability Messaging
The frozen dessert industry faces increasing scrutiny over single-use packaging, making sustainable choices essential for businesses wanting to attract environmentally conscious customers. Our wholesale recyclable ice cream cups address these concerns through thoughtful material selection and lifecycle planning.
FSC-certified paperboard originates from responsibly managed forests where harvesting aligns with regeneration rates, preventing deforestation and habitat destruction. The certification provides transparency through chain-of-custody documentation, supporting credible sustainability claims that resonate with conscious consumers. This verified sourcing demonstrates genuine environmental commitment rather than vague eco-friendly assertions that skeptical customers dismiss as greenwashing.
Aqueous coating using water-based formulations eliminates plastic liners while maintaining moisture resistance ice cream cups require. Traditional cups often use polyethylene coatings that compromise recyclability and compostability, forcing customers to choose between functionality and environmental responsibility. Our water-based alternative delivers comparable performance while maintaining paper's natural biodegradability, creating genuine sustainable solutions rather than false choices.
Compostable specifications break down completely in commercial composting facilities within 90 days, transforming from packaging into nutrient-rich soil. This end-of-life pathway proves especially appropriate for dessert businesses where cups often contain residual product making traditional recycling challenging. Composting accepts food-contaminated cups readily, unlike recycling streams requiring cleaning most customers skip. The complete biodegradation also addresses microplastic concerns associated with plastic cups that fragment but never fully disappear.
Recyclable through standard paper streams provides disposal flexibility for customers without commercial composting access. The single-material construction means cups can enter curbside recycling or drop-off programs without component separation, dramatically increasing actual recycling rates compared to multi-material packaging requiring disassembly. Many municipalities accept these cups in paper recycling even with minor ice cream residue, as processing facilities handle food contamination from dessert cups readily.
